Saturday March 23rd 2024. Ditchling, Sussex
Hilary Bourne (1909-2004) and Barbara Allen (1903-1972) lived, travelled, designed, made, studied and sold textiles as a couple from 1936 until Barbara’s tragic death in a fire in 1972.
How is it possible that the two women who designed and wove the textiles for the Royal Festival Hall (1951), the fabrics for the costumes for Ben Hur (1959), the upholstery for the newest glitzy jet planes ever to fly in the UK (c1952), who sold curtains at Heal’s and Liberty and ran a renowned, highly profitable London business together - in both their names - for nearly 40 years, have remained uncredited in the British history of Modernist Art and Design?
Is it because they are women in craft?
Towards the end of their lives they created the museum at Ditchling together in 1985.1

Text from the exhibition interpretation panels at Double Weave – Bourne and Allen’s Modernist Textiles at the Ditchling Museum.
